If the front clip is perfect, no rust, no dents, and includes everything from the fenders forward. I'm cheap so I'd try to get'em to go as cheap as possible by offering a few hundred dollars to see how they stand on price, then go from there. you just have to set a limit in your mind on what the most you will spend is, and how bad you want it. Just dont' get ripped off. By price, fenders in good cond go from 150-225, a clean cowl hood non functioning about 2-250, core supports are pretty cheap about 50-75 bucks, but if you were to nickle and dime the clip together you would have probably close to a grand spent once you get the filler, brackets, wells, extensions and bezels. For an all in one price I'd personally probably 500-750 depending on how bad I wanted it.
